Job title: General labourer days – Brantford

Job description: Come and join a team of general labourers to assist with assembling and forming racks in a large volume manufacturing plant in central Brantford (Henry Street area). You’re flexible enough to help out where needed and work overtime when required. You have some previous experience with general labour. If you take pleasure in being part of creating something of value and don’t like to miss a day of work, you believe a job well done is the only way to do it, then this is the job for you! Must be a go-getter who enjoys physical work. …

The work is straightforward. You have a lot of independence with your work and the supervisor does not hover over your shoulder to ensure the job is done right – he/she trusts you! You may have the opportunity to be certified in welding and gain MIG welding experience in your career here.

Job Title: General labourer
Location: Brantford, Ontario
Shift: 6:30 am to 4 pm
Monday to Thursday
Pay Rate: $20/hour
